Occipital Lobe
The rearmost area of each cerebral hemisphere; includes tissue crucial for processing visual information.
Simple Reaction Time
The time it takes for a person to respond to a stimulus, such as a light or sound, with a simple response like a button press.
Choice Reaction Time
The time it takes for a person to make a decision between multiple stimuli, indicating the speed of decision making and cognitive processing.
Lexical Access Time
The amount of time it takes for a person to retrieve and recognize a word from memory, reflecting efficiency in language comprehension.
